Part I. Dynamic urban planet. Part II. Global urban sustainable development Part III. Urban transformations to sustainability Part IV. Provocations from practice.
Global urbanization promises better services, stronger economies, and more connections; it also carries risks and unforeseeable consequences. To deepen our understanding of this complex process and its importance for global sustainability, we need to build interdisciplinary knowledge around a systems approach.
